I added support to my layout, granted it only works while not in combat which is all I wanted/needed. This will work for now until we can get a more correct way to do it.
Lua Code:
local function PostCreateIcon(Auras, button)
button.count = mnkLibs.createFontString(button, mnkLibs.Fonts.ap, 10, nil, nil, true)
button.count:ClearAllPoints()
button.count:SetPoint('TOPRIGHT', button, 0, 2)
button.timer = mnkLibs.createFontString(button, mnkLibs.Fonts.ap, 10, nil, nil, true)
button.timer:ClearAllPoints()
button.timer:SetPoint('BOTTOMLEFT', button, 0, 0)
button.icon:SetTexCoord(.07, .93, .07, .93)
button:SetScript('OnClick', function(self, button) CancelUnitBuff('player', self:GetName():match('%d')) end)
mnkLibs.createBorder(button, 1,-1,-1,1, {0,0,0,1})
end